Thanks. It was a fun project to do. It took a little bit of planning to figure out the materials to use and how to attach them to the trailer.

I don't have to back up all the way so the deck of the trailer top is flush with the water. I can pull the pontoon off and on the deck with it about 2-3 inches above water level so only need to back the trailer into the water so a portion of the trailer wheels are below water. My truck wheels stay on the ramp and out of the water.

It also allows me to leave my motor and fish finder mounted along with oars and the only thing I add when the pontoon is in the water is my battery and cooler and rod.

I currently am using an automotive battery which is quite heavy. Do any of you use lighter weight 12 volts to run your trolling motors/fish finders? If so I'd love to get some battery recommendations for something lighter.
